Does anyone know any 1-click menu systems
I am wondering if anyone knows of some decent 1-click to load menu system, what allow a lot of options, ideally also with several options per menu item, or at least, what "execute" a script on exit, for example:
{ cd :game game } There is a menu system I recently found, cannot remember where, and its called "Get Set Go!" and running it without a menu file, it shows the author as Mark Everingham (C)1990 Freudian Slipz, and has no mention about distribution, or any documentation on the disk, so I guess I can use it, but its sadly limited to 10 options (it was on an ADF I think) - But this is not ideal for the KS3.1 HDF image since it is limited in options I used to like the Novell Netware Menu System way back, that had menus and submenus where you could put options to load the games, I use a version called PCMENU on DOSbox for example, so something similar to this would be ideal) Many Thanks |
